4xxx Series Aluminium
4xxx Series Aluminium Alloys feature silicon as their main alloying element. The silicon content ranges from 1.4% to around 13%, which serves to increase the strength of 4xxx series alloys correlative to the silicon addition, at the expense of ductility.
These alloys have good mechanical strength, corrosion resistance similar to that of 3xxx series, decent machinability when an oil-based lubricant is used, and very good weldability
4xxx Series Alloys are used to create high-performance race car components including pistons, engine components, and chassis components, whilst also being a family synonymous for creating welding rods and brazing plates.
